About us Rainbow Dreams Early Learning Academy The primary focus of the Rainbow Dreams Early Learning Academy is to work with the “at risk” and “under-served” population of Las Vegas as defined by state statutes. We provide a firm educational foundation while encouraging diversity and cultural appreciation. We provide smaller more manageable teacher-to-student ratios and a highly qualified faculty and staff. We also offer outreach support programs to maximize collaboration between parents, students, and faculty and we pride ourselves on providing a challenging academic curriculum that focuses on early childhood literacy and STEAM programming. Teacher-Kindergarten Position Details Classification: Certified Terms of Employment: This is a salaried position assigned to a 9-month schedule Position Summary: The teacher will implement into daily student instruction appropriate educational curriculum based on the Nevada Academic Content Standards. The teacher will create and maintain an educational atmosphere that encourages effective student learning and supports school and the mission and values of Rainbow Dreams Academy. This person will report directly to the school site administrator. Essential Duties and Responsibilities: The list of Essential Duties and Responsibilities is not exhaustive and may be supplemented. 1. Administers appropriate District curriculum which is aligned with the NVACS. 2. Ensures the opportunity for all students to learn in a supportive environment. 3. Creates and maintains a positive, orderly, and academically focused learning condition in the instructional environment. 4. Develops and implements the Components of an Effective Lesson for instruction. 5. Analyzes student progress and provides appropriate instruction. 6. Provides a classroom management/discipline plan ensuring safety at all times. 7. Ensures assessment regulations and guidelines are followed at all times. 8. Develops a classroom climate that promotes positive learning conditions. 9. Works professionally with administration, staff, parents, and the community. 10. Integrates technology into the instructional program. 11. Participates in other job-related duties and activities related to the position, as assigned. Position Expectations: 1. Demonstrate knowledge, skill, and ability to provide instruction in an elementary classroom. 2. Work cooperatively with students, parents, peers, administration, and community members. 3. Guide the learning process toward achievement of curriculum goals. 4. Establish and communicate clear objectives for all lessons, units, and projects. 5. Employ a variety of instructional techniques and strategies aligned with instructional objectives in order to meet the needs of all students. 6. Participate as an active member with other faculty and staff. 7. Maintain accurate and complete records as required by law and District policy. 8. Maintain and improve professional competence. 9. Communicate effectively both written and orally. Position Requirements Education and Training An earned b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university. Master’s degree preferred. Licenses and Certifications Must possess or be able to acquire by time of appointment to the position, a teaching license issued by the Nevada Department of Education. Must be certified in relevant subject area.
